Debian - Info on adding Plex repo is outdated

Server Version#: (Newest - Can’t Update to it!)

I’m using Plex instructions (https://support.plex.tv/articles/235974187-enable-repository-updating-for-supported-linux-server-distributions/) and I tried to add the key for the repo with the line:

curl https://downloads.plex.tv/plex-keys/PlexSign.key | sudo apt-key add -

When I do, I get an error:

Warning: apt-key is deprecated. Manage keyring files in trusted.gpg.d instead (see apt-key(8)).
gpg: no valid OpenPGP data found.

How to fix this? Will it still work with Debian, or is the server and this page deprecated?

What do I need to do to add the repo to a Debian system?

What Debian release are you using? The portion of the instructions you snipped above is only relevant to Debian versions before 10.

The correct way to install Plex Media Server on Debian 10 or later is to perform the initial installation using the appropriate PMS package from here:

https://www.plex.tv/media-server-downloads/?cat=computer&plat=linux#plex-media-server

The installation process automatically creates the repo source in /etc/apt/sources.list.d/. You only need to uncomment the repo in plexmediaserver.list in that directory and perform an apt update.

Future public PMS updates will then be available via APT. Note that Plex Pass betas are not available via APT.
